Most Medium characters are between 5'-6' so their vertical reach after a 10' running start is between 7.5'-9' and then modified by 3+STR for an end result of at least 10.5'-12'.
A small character, or a character with a negative STR modifier might not be able to jump as high ... but we don't really have that issue in this group (everyone is size Medium and no one has a negative STR modifier).
The catwalk is 10' up. As long as a character can jump & reach to at least a 10' vertical ... they could grab the edge and climb up.
The only penalty to this movement would be that jumping and climbing both count as difficult terrain ... so going from 0' elevation to 10' elevation will take 30' of movement (a 10' head start, and then 20' of jumping/climbing to ascend the required 10').
